No, there is no direct bus from Newark to Franklin Lakes. However, there are services departing from Newark station and arriving at Franklin Lakes station via Port Authority Bus Terminal.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 2h 13m.
Newark to Franklin Lakes bus services, operated by Greyhound USA, depart from Newark Penn Station.
Newark to Franklin Lakes bus services, operated by Greyhound USA, arrive at Franklin Ave & Old Mill Rd station.
